摘要
A fiber-packed needle extraction device was used as a novel method for the extraction of bisphenol A from water samples. A bundle of filaments having a coating of polydimethylsiloxane was packed longitudinally into the needle. Good extraction efficiency was obtained even for an extraction time of 10 min, when the water sample was pumped through the needle with a syringe pump. The needle could be used repeatedly. The preparation procedure, included a derivatization process. Under optimum conditions, use of the fiber-packed needle showed a higher extraction efficiency than conventional sample preparation methods such as liquid-liquid extraction and solid-phase extraction.
